comparison libpurple/protocols/msn/userlist.c @ 25798:aa876d48b5b2

Some more struct hiding.
author Sadrul Habib Chowdhury <imadil@gmail.com>
date Fri, 31 Oct 2008 09:24:43 +0000
parents 5ace6c024230
children 8d562557ed6f
comparison
equal deleted inserted replaced
25797:da46097b4722 25798:aa876d48b5b2
881 GSList *l; 881 GSList *l;
882 MsnUser * user; 882 MsnUser * user;
883 883
884 g_return_if_fail(gc != NULL); 884 g_return_if_fail(gc != NULL);
885 885
886 for (gnode = purple_blist_get_root(); gnode; gnode = gnode->next) 886 for (gnode = purple_blist_get_root(); gnode;
887 gnode = purple_blist_node_get_sibling_next(gnode))
887 { 888 {
888 if (!PURPLE_BLIST_NODE_IS_GROUP(gnode)) 889 if (!PURPLE_BLIST_NODE_IS_GROUP(gnode))
889 continue; 890 continue;
890 for (cnode = gnode->child; cnode; cnode = cnode->next) 891 for (cnode = purple_blist_node_get_first_child(gnode);
892 cnode;
893 cnode = purple_blist_node_get_sibling_next(cnode))
891 { 894 {
892 if (!PURPLE_BLIST_NODE_IS_CONTACT(cnode)) 895 if (!PURPLE_BLIST_NODE_IS_CONTACT(cnode))
893 continue; 896 continue;
894 for (bnode = cnode->child; bnode; bnode = bnode->next) 897 for (bnode = purple_blist_node_get_first_child(cnode);
898 bnode;
899 bnode = purple_blist_node_get_sibling_next(bnode))
895 { 900 {
896 PurpleBuddy *b; 901 PurpleBuddy *b;
897 if (!PURPLE_BLIST_NODE_IS_BUDDY(bnode)) 902 if (!PURPLE_BLIST_NODE_IS_BUDDY(bnode))
898 continue; 903 continue;
899 b = (PurpleBuddy *)bnode; 904 b = (PurpleBuddy *)bnode;